--- Begin Message ---Package: dconf Version: 0.5.1-2 Severity: wishlist For Debian you should change the following sections of the dconf default config: Section: [dhcp] Add /etc/dhcp3/dhclient.conf, /etc/dhcp3/dhclient-enter-hooks.d/* /etc/dhcp3/dhclient-exit-hooks.d/* Section: [apache] Add /etc/apache2/apache2.conf /etc/apache2/sites-enabled/* /etc/apache2/mods-enabled/* /etc/apache2/conf.d/* Section: [bind] Add /etc/bin/named.conf.local Section: [amavis] Add /etc/amavis/conf.d/* Section: [nagios] Add /etc/nagios2/conf.d/* /etc/nagios2/services/* /etc/nagios2/hosts/* /etc/nagios2/*.cfg Section: [php] Add /etc/php5/conf.d/* /etc/php5/apache2/php.ini /etc/php5/apache2/conf.d/* Section: [postfix] Add /etc/postfix/sasl/smtpd.conf Section: [apt] Add /etc/apt/sources.list.d/* /etc/apt/preferences Thats all for the first try :) Thanks Alex -- System Information: Debian Release: lenny/sid APT prefers unstable APT policy: (500, 'unstable'), (1, 'experimental') Architecture: i386 (i686) Kernel: Linux 2.6.23-rc3-git2 (SMP w/2 CPU cores; PREEMPT) Locale: LANG=de_DE.UTF-8, LC_CTYPE=de_DE@euro (charmap=ISO-8859-15) Shell: /bin/sh linked to /bin/bash Versions of packages dconf depends on: ii python 2.4.4-6 An interactive high-level object-o dconf recommends no packages. -- no debconf information
